Reginald's obituary

Born in Cleveland, Ohio, Reginald Stewart Harrell, Jr. was the first-born child of Mildred and the late Reginald Harrell on August 3, 1971. He passed away at the age of 49 on Friday, September 11, 2020 at Fairview General Hospital.

Reggie was baptized and gave his life to Christ at the age of 13 at Second Missionary Baptist Church in Cleveland. He attended Grace Mount Elementary, Charles W. Eliot, and John F. Kennedy High school in Cleveland, Ohio. Upon graduation from high school, Reggie served in the U.S. Navy. He later worked several jobs, but his final work experience was at Foote Printing as a tow motor driver and paper cutter for numerous years. In his spare time his main hobby was playing video games and shopping online.

Reggie loved life, family and had a tremendous love for dancing and his friends. Those who knew Reggie knew of him as a hard worker, full of humor and the life of the family get-togethers.

Reggie was a dedicated father who blessed the family with three sons, Reginald Harrell, III – (wife) Cherry, Jailen and Marcus, which were his pride and joy. He leaves behind his mother Mildred Harrell, sister Yolanda Rogers – (husband) Clifton, niece Chayse Rogers, nephew Caiden Rogers, granddaughter Winter Harrell along with a host of Aunts, Uncles, Cousins and Friends that are too numerous to mention, but know that they are loved and will always remain in his heart.
